Abstract
327,004. Bath, J. March 22, 1929. Screwing-dies are formed by first finishing and hardening a die block and then forming parallel grooves in the block from the solid hardened metal by repeated grinding operations. In a machine for carrying out this method a profiled grinding-wheel W is mounted on a spindle 20 driven from a motor 32 and mounted on a vertical slide 22 which may be adjusted by a screw 25 operated by a hand-wheel provided with a graduated head. The die D is mounted on a slide 33 which is carried on a cross-slide 35 moving over ways 36 and actuated by a hydraulic cylinder 62. The feed of the block longitudinally of the grinding- spindle is effected by a screw 40 which may be rotated by change gearing 43 - - 46 operated by an arm 47 provided with a handle 50. The arm 47 carries a spring plunger 51 coacting with a stop 52. The gearing is so arranged that, when the arm is rotated through one revolution after first withdrawing the plunger 51, the block D is fed through a distance equal to the pitch of the gears to be cut. The die block is mounted on a magnetic chuck 63 and is accurately positioned against a stop 71 by means of a gauge bar 65 having projections 66, 67, the projection 66 being engaged with the edge 69 of an angle block 68 and the other projection being spaced from this edge by precision gauge pieces 70 according to the inclination of the grooves to be ground. The grinding-wheel is trued by means of tools 72, which may operate in the manner described in Specification 327,003, [Class 60, Grinding or abrading &c.], the amount of material removed from the wheel being accurately indicated and being compensated by lowering the grinding- wheel. In order to measure the depth of the thread a round wire 74 of determined diameter is placed in the thread groove and the distance between the bottom of the block and the top of the wire is measured by a micrometer 75. The wheel is lubricated during operation by fluid directed irom a pair of nozzles 76. In operation the finished and hardened blank is placed in position and the table reciprocated while the wheel is gradually fed downwards until the desired depth of thread is attained. The wheel is then raised and the arm 47 rotated to move the die block through one pitch, the grinding operation being repeated until all the grooves are cut. Finally a finishing cut is taken over all the grooves so as to bring the grooves to a uniform depth.
